Pounce
Pounce monitors X and Reddit continuously, runs incoming posts through AI filters tuned to your target audience, and surfaces only the conversations worth engaging. The core workflow is a 15-minute session: posts stream in, AI drafts a reply in your voice, you edit and send. That loop fits founders and sales reps who cannot afford a full-time community manager. The ceiling appears when your targeting strategy grows complex — the tool does not expose deep boolean query logic, and filter tuning happens through session feedback rather than explicit rule editing. Teams managing outreach across several distinct audiences report that keeping multiple strategies cleanly separated requires discipline the interface does not enforce for them.

Xnorly
The tool ingests data across ads platforms, spreadsheets, and operational reports, then surfaces executive-level briefings and threshold-triggered alerts through channels like Slack or WhatsApp — so the insight lands where decisions actually get made. For small to mid-sized teams replacing manual dashboard reviews, this replaces a recurring meeting. The ceiling appears when your data model grows complex: multi-condition branching logic and cross-source joins beyond basic correlation are not described in available documentation. Teams needing that depth add a dedicated BI layer alongside it, which means maintaining two systems.
